摘要
针对于室内环境中传统标记号指向寻物效率较低,难以快速准确获取物品位置信息的问题,提出了一种直观、高效的定位指向解决方案。将超宽带室内定位技术与光束控制技术相结合,基于信号到达时间定位模型,采用对称双向双边测距方案获取信标与基站间的距离,上传至上位机中经三边定位算法计算出信标位置。指向时,将物品位置通过光束指向算法转换为光束灯的水平与垂直偏转角度,再进行DMX512协议编码后控制光束灯指向目标位置,以达到物品的精准定位与指向。系统经过验证,定位精度可达0.091 m,指向精度可达0.032 m,与传统标记号指向寻物相比,可减少近一半寻物耗时,系统定位与指向都具有较高的精度,可提高人工寻找物品的效率。
Aiming at the problem of low efficiency of traditional marker pointing to find objects in indoor environment and difficulty in quickly and accurately obtaining the location information of objects, an intuitive and efficient positioning and pointing solution is proposed. Combining ultra-wideband indoor positioning technology and beam control technology, based on the signal arrival time positioning model, adopts a symmetrical two-way bilateral ranging scheme to obtain the distance between the beacon and the base station, and uploads it to the host computer to calculate the beacon by the trilateral positioning algorithm position. When pointing, the position of the item is converted into the horizontal and vertical deflection angle of the beam lamp through the beam pointing algorithm, and then the DMX512 protocol is coded to control the beam lamp to point to the target position to achieve precise positioning and pointing of the item. The system has been verified, the positioning accuracy can reach 0.091 m, and the pointing accuracy can reach 0.032 m. Compared with the traditional tag number pointing to the object, it can reduce the time for searching by nearly half. The system positioning and pointing have high accuracy, which can be effectively improved.
作者
李祥
何志毅
何宁
LI Xiang;HE Zhiyi;HE Ning(School of Information and Communication,Guilin University of Electronic Technology,Guilin 541004,China;Guangxi Key Laboratory of Wireless Wideband Communication and Signal Processing,Guilin University of Electronic Technology,Guilin 541004,China)
出处
《桂林电子科技大学学报》
2021年第4期273-279,共7页
Journal of Guilin University of Electronic Technology
基金
国家自然科学基金(61961008)。
关键词
室内定位
仓储管理
超宽带
光束指向
indoor positioning
warehouse management
UWB
beam pointing